Introduction
The Volkswagen Group has made significant progress in its joint venture with Rivian, the electric vehicle (EV) manufacturer renowned for its innovative technology. Recently, the partnership reached an important milestone as it successfully completed winter testing of Rivian’s technology integrated into VW vehicles. This achievement has unlocked an additional $1 billion investment from Volkswagen, further solidifying their commitment to expanding the electric vehicle market.
Key Milestone Achieved
The completion of winter testing is a critical step for both companies, demonstrating the practical application of Rivian’s technology in various driving conditions. Volkswagen’s extensive testing protocols showed promising results, ensuring that Rivian’s capabilities align with the high standards expected in VW’s lineup.
